1. Why Pressure Measurement Matters in Water Treatment

In the water treatment industry, pressure is the primary metric for system health. Whether it is membrane separation or pump station control, stable monitoring is the key to:

  • Operational Efficiency: Optimizing energy consumption.
  • Equipment Protection: Preventing abnormal pressure conditions and protect membrane systems.
  • System Longevity: Providing real-time data to facilitate predictive maintenance.

4. Common Applications in Water Treatment Systems

Reverse Osmosis (RO) Systems & RO Skids: RO system manufacturers require high-pressure resistant transmitters to monitor membrane inlet and concentrate pressure securely.

Ultrafiltration (UF) Systems: UF units rely on precise water treatment pressure transmitter modules for accurate transmembrane pressure (TMP) monitoring.

MBR & Wastewater Treatment Systems: Specialized wastewater pressure sensors are essential to manage heavy sludge, high solid contents, and corrosive environments.

Desalination Equipment: Equipment in highly corrosive seawater environments demands specialized wetted material compatibility.

Booster Pump & Water Supply Systems: Rapid-response sensors are vital for smooth constant pressure water supply control.

5. How to Select Pressure Transmitters for OEM Applications

Media Compatibility: Wetted parts (e.g., 316L SS) designed to withstand aggressive water and chemical media.

Overpressure & Shock Protection: Robust resistance against frequent pump startup/shutdown pressure surges.

Long-Term Stability: Excellent long-term stability with minimal drift under continuous 24/7 operation.

  • Output Signal & Protocol: Seamless integration with PLCs via 4-20mA, RS485 (Modbus), or HART.

6. OEM Pressure Transmitter Selection Checklist

Before contacting a supplier, prepare the following parameters to accelerate your technical evaluation and quotation process:

  • Application / Working Environment: (e.g., RO skid, MBR wastewater, Booster pump)
  • Medium: (e.g., Raw water, RO permeate, corrosive wastewater)
  • Pressure Range & Type: (e.g., 0-1.6 MPa Gauge, Differential)
  • Operating Temperature: (e.g., -20°C to 80°C)
  • Process Connection Type: (e.g., G1/2, NPT1/2, Flange)
  • Output Signal: (e.g., 4-20mA, RS485 Modbus)
  • Estimated Annual Quantity: (For OEM batch scheduling and pricing)

Q1: What pressure transmitter is suitable for RO water treatment systems?

A: High-accuracy transmitters with robust overpressure protection and stable 4-20mA or digital outputs are recommended to protect membranes from pressure spikes.

Q2: What is the best pressure transmitter material for wastewater applications?

A: 316L stainless steel wetted parts combined with flush diaphragm designs or anti-corrosive coatings are ideal for preventing clogging and chemical erosion in wastewater and MBR systems.
